I got to spend time today doing something I wanted to do,instead of what someone else needed.I turned wrenches for about 7 hours today.I installed sleeves,pistons,and rings in one of my F12 Farmalls.Hooked the motor up to the trany,Installed the mag,oil filter and mag rod.Im waiting on parts from Rice,and hope the head is ready fron the machine shop.This is the F12 that I bought from our local steam engine show,Its got steel wheels on the back,and a home made wide front on the front.The motor was locked up.I try to buy a tractor each year thats a fence row special and take it back the following year running.
